#5902be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5902be is composed of 34.9% red, 0.8%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.2% cyan, 98.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 267.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 37.6%. #5902be color hex could be obtained by blending #b204ff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#5902be color description : Strong violet.
#5902be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5902be has RGB values of R:89, G:2,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5833406.
